@article{fdi:010055991, title = {{D}eep-sea origin and in-situ diversification of {C}hrysogorgiid octocorals}, author = {{P}ante, {E}. and {F}rance, {S}. {C}. and {C}ouloux, {A}. and {C}ruaud, {C}. and {M}c{F}adden, {C}. {S}. and {S}amadi, {S}arah and {W}atling, {L}.}, editor = {}, language = {{ENG}}, abstract = {{T}he diversity, ubiquity and prevalence in deep waters of the octocoral family {C}hrysogorgiidae {V}errill, 1883 make it noteworthy as a model system to study radiation and diversification in the deep sea. {H}ere we provide the first comprehensive phylogenetic analysis of the {C}hrysogorgiidae, and compare phylogeny and depth distribution. {P}hylogenetic relationships among 10 of 14 currently-described {C}hrysogorgiidae genera were inferred based on mitochondrial (mt{M}ut{S}, cox1) and nuclear (18{S}) markers. {B}athymetric distribution was estimated from multiple sources, including museum records, a literature review, and our own sampling records (985 stations, 2345 specimens). {G}enetic analyses suggest that the {C}hrysogorgiidae as currently described is a polyphyletic family. {S}hallow-water genera, and two of eight deep-water genera, appear more closely related to other octocoral families than to the remainder of the monophyletic, deep-water chrysogorgiid genera. {M}onophyletic chrysogorgiids are composed of strictly ({I}ridogorgia {V}errill, 1883, {M}etallogorgia {V}ersluys, 1902, {R}adicipes {S}tearns, 1883, {P}seudochrysogorgia {P}ante & {F}rance, 2010) and predominantly ({C}hrysogorgia {D}uchassaing & {M}ichelotti, 1864) deep-sea genera that diversified in situ. {T}his group is sister to gold corals ({P}rimnoidae {M}ilne {E}dwards, 1857) and deep-sea bamboo corals ({K}eratoisidinae {G}ray, 1870), whose diversity also peaks in the deep sea. {N}ine species of {C}hrysogorgia that were described from depths shallower than 200 m, and mt{M}ut{S} haplotypes sequenced from specimens sampled as shallow as 101 m, suggest a shallow-water emergence of some {C}hrysogorgia species.}, keywords = {}, booktitle = {}, journal = {{P}los {O}ne}, volume = {7}, numero = {6}, pages = {e38357}, ISSN = {1932-6203}, year = {2012}, DOI = {10.1371/journal.pone.0038357}, URL = {https://www.documentation.ird.fr/hor/fdi:010055991}, }
